Stretch Marks and Pregnancy don't Necessarily go Hand-in-Hand

by Gabriell Rygh

Pregnancy is a moment all women look forward to, however, there factors that can make this wondrous moment seem less joyful than you had imagined. For example one of the worst consequences of pregnancy is the appearance of stretch marks.

During pregnancy, your skin will begin to stretch due to weight gain and liquid retention. You may notice that stretch marks appear around the breasts, hips and abdomen. Depending on how much weight you gain, you may also develop stretch marks on your thighs and upper arms.

Here are a few tips to help you prevent and treat stretch marks during and after pregnancy. Also keep in mind that these tips can help you treat stretch marks due to puberty, weight fluctuations, and exercise.

How to Prevent Stretch Marks Before and During Pregnancy

Your doctor can prescribe a series of different products that will help your skin accommodate itself to the stretching that occurs during pregnancy. These products, which are usually creams for stretch marks, help keep your skin taut and flexible. If used correctly they will help your skin stretch beyond its limits without breaking.

Along with these creams it is important to maintain a steady weight gain. Keep in mind that even though eating your favorite chocolate cake can be tempting, sudden weight gain will increase your probabilities of developing stretch marks not to mention it may cause health issues that can affect your unborn child.

A healthy diet can do wonders for controlling your weight gain. Most women see pregnancy as an opportunity to eat all the delicious things they aren't usually allowed to eat, however, there is no excuse for eating everything you see because you only really need about 300 extra calories a day.

Say NO to overly processed foods and junk foods. These are high in sodium and contain empty calories which will rapidly increase your weight.
